Singer Diana Ross arrives Nigeria for ThisDay Awards

18 years after headlining the 12th THISDAY Awards in 2007, at the Muson Centre, American diva, Diana Ross, has arrived in Lagos, Nigeria, for the 2025 edition of the THISDAY Awards ceremony scheduled for Monday, January 27, 2025, at the Eko Hotel and Suites, Victoria Island.

Ross is headlining this year’s awards ceremony commemorating the newspaper’s 30th Anniversary and Arise News television’s 12th year in broadcasting.

On Sunday morning, airport sources sighted Ms Ross and her entourage at the Murtala Muhammed International Airport in Lagos.

Easily one of America’s most iconic and celebrated female singers, Ross, continues to perform through the years after she closed out her successful Las Vegas residency in 2017. This year, she is set to launch her “Celebrating Timeless Classics 2025 Tour” starting on Valentine’s Day in Highland, California.

Some of her songs include “Ain’t No Mountain High Enough” and “You Can’t Hurry Love” and who can forget the nostalgic Motown hits like “Stop! In the Name of Love” and the popular “I’m Coming Out.”
